Junior League's traveling mural to be at museum


YOUNGSTOWN — The 2006-2007 provisional class of the Junior League of Youngstown will create a traveling mural depicting the “Past, Present, and Future of Youngstown.”

The task of painting the mural will be held from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. Sunday and again on May 6 at the Children’s Museum of Youngstown, 139 E. Boardman St.

The mural will be painted in six 4x6-foot sections that can be moved to different venues around the city.

The project embodies the spirit and positions of the Junior League on voluntarism, children, education, individuals who have made an impact on Youngstown, and revitalization.

Bob Barko, president of Steel Town Studios, has been assisting and sketching the mural on masonite boards. He will also oversee the painters both days. Eddie Davidson, a league sustainer and an art teacher at Boardman High School, has assisted in coordinating the student component of the mural. Gift certificates and supplies for the mural have been donated by Home Depot, Star Supply, Sherwin-Williams Co. and Pat Catan’s.
